General Information about #195FBD
The hexadecimal color #195FBD, commonly referred to as Denim, is a dark and saturated shade of blue. It is composed of 9.8% red, 37.3% green, and 74.1% blue. In the RGB color space, it represents a mixture of these primary colors. The CMYK representation is 87% cyan, 50% magenta, 0% yellow, and 26% black. Applications
Web Development
In web development, Denim (#195FBD) can be effectively used for creating visually appealing and trustworthy website designs. Its calming and professional appearance makes it suitable for header backgrounds, button highlights, and navigation menus, particularly for corporate or educational websites. When combined with lighter accent colors, such as white or light gray, it can create a clean and modern aesthetic that enhances user experience. It's also appropriate for charts and graphs to display data in an easy-to-understand format.
